Benefits training program management involves leading the development and delivery of comprehensive programs, quality control efforts, data analysis and reporting, community outreach initiatives and special projects leadership across a range of areas.

Responsibilities include:

  • Coordinating onboarding for new benefit programs specialists through comprehensive training in SNAP Medicaid policy practice.
  • Developing and managing refresher materials for SNAP Medicaid trainings for tenured employees.
  • Providing case consultation on state and federal regulations and eligibility systems to benefit programs specialists.
